How to register to vote:
Online: Visit registertovote.ca.gov and complete your registration in minutes.
By Mail: Pick up a paper registration form at the DMV, post office, or public library, fill it out, and mail it before the deadline.
In-Person: Register at your county elections office, polling place, or vote center before or on Election Day.
Same-Day Registration: Missed the deadline? No problem! You can complete Same-Day Voter Registration at a vote center and cast your ballot.

Key Deadlines
The standard voter registration deadline in California is 15 days before Election Day, but rules and dates may vary. For the latest updates, visit nass.org/can-I-vote.
Missed the deadline? No worries! California offers Same-Day Voter Registration, allowing you to complete the process and vote at a designated vote center.
